How Exercise Can Improve Erectile Function

Erectile dysfunction (ED) affects millions of men worldwide and can have a significant impact on their overall quality of life. While medications are commonly used to treat ED, there are also non-pharmacological approaches that can be effective. One such approach is exercise, which has been shown to improve erectile function in men. In this article, we will explore how exercise can improve erectile function and how it can be used in conjunction with medications to achieve optimal results.

Exercise is known to have many health benefits, including improving cardiovascular health, reducing stress and anxiety, and promoting overall well-being. Studies have shown that regular exercise can also improve erectile function by improving blood flow to the penis, reducing inflammation, and promoting the production of nitric oxide. Nitric oxide is a key chemical that helps to dilate blood vessels in the penis, allowing for increased blood flow and improved erectile function.

One study published in the Journal of Sexual Medicine found that men who exercised for 40 minutes three to four times per week had significant improvements in their erectile function compared to sedentary men. The study also found that exercise improved other aspects of sexual function, including orgasm and satisfaction.

Another study published in the International Journal of Impotence Research found that a combination of aerobic exercise and resistance training improved erectile function in men with ED who were taking sildenafil (Viagra). The study found that men who exercised in addition to taking sildenafil had better outcomes than men who only took the medication.

Exercise can also help to improve the underlying causes of ED, such as obesity, high blood pressure, and diabetes. These conditions can all contribute to erectile dysfunction by affecting blood flow and nerve function in the penis. Exercise can help to reduce the risk of these conditions and improve overall health, which can in turn improve erectile function.

It is important to note that not all types of exercise are created equal when it comes to improving erectile function. Aerobic exercise, such as running, swimming, or cycling, has been shown to be particularly effective at improving blood flow and reducing inflammation. Resistance training, such as weightlifting, can also be beneficial by increasing testosterone levels and improving overall muscle function.

Men who are interested in using exercise to improve their erectile function should speak with their healthcare provider to develop a safe and effective exercise plan. They should also be sure to start slowly and gradually increase the intensity and duration of their workouts to avoid injury.

In addition to exercise, there are other lifestyle changes that can help to improve erectile function. These include eating a healthy diet, quitting smoking, and reducing alcohol intake. These changes can help to improve overall health and reduce the risk of conditions that can contribute to ED.
